首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

TypeScript中assert.rejects的等价物是什么?

在TypeScript中,assert.rejects的等价物是chai-as-promised库中的expect().to.be.rejected。chai-as-promised是一个流行的断言库,用于在测试异步代码时处理promise的断言。使用该库,可以很方便地测试promise的拒绝情况。

chai-as-promised提供了一个expect方法,可用于对promise进行各种断言。其中,expect().to.be.rejected用于断言promise被拒绝。它可以与其他chai断言链式调用,用于进一步精确定义拒绝的条件。

以下是chai-as-promised的相关信息和腾讯云产品链接:

  • chai-as-promised库:chai-as-promised是chai断言库的一个插件,用于处理promise断言。它可以在Node.js和浏览器环境中使用。了解更多信息,请访问chai-as-promised GitHub页面
  • 腾讯云产品链接:腾讯云提供了丰富的云计算服务,包括云服务器、容器服务、对象存储等。了解腾讯云的产品和服务,请访问腾讯云官网
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 区块链与数字货币是什么关系呢?

    我们都知道,区块链技术具有去中心化、稳定、安全等特点,我们一直探讨的问题是区块链技术的运用领域和运用手段,在银链原子链开发的项目中,区块链技术得到良好的施展平台。 区块链正在带来的一个新的商业模式,我叫它分布式商业模式,比特币区块链就是这方面一个伟大的实验,即使它失败了也带来巨大的启示价值,2000亿衡量不了,我认为2万亿美元也衡量不了它。分布式商业有几个特点,第一个分布式是没有产权的,大部分软件都是开源的。任何人要成为比特币上一个节点,不需要任何人许可,只需要下载软件,所有的都是开源,免费。使用是免费的。

    010
    领券